On 8/31/2011 3:44 PM, Cap Pennell wrote: > Still better, I think, for old digipeater Sysops to just add UIDigi WIDE1-1 > in the Kantronics version KPC3-3F427265-8.2 TNC as previously recommended. > http://www.aprs.org/kpc3/kpc3+82WIDEn.txt > In practice, this certainly works well enough. > In California, we build our fixed VHF digi network to support a user's path > of WIDE1-1,WIDE2-1 (or less) from anywhere. A digi that won't operate > packets addressed via WIDE1-1 isn't of much use. > 73, Cap KE6AFE > Correction: "In *NORTHERN* California, we build our fixed VHF digi network to support a user's path of WIDE1-1,WIDE2-1 (or less) from anywhere." SoCal ignores WIDE1-1
